Web19 Nov 2024 · Three glasses of champagne per person when it’s served as table wine is the recommended serving size. Dessert Wine. Considering that dessert wine is served at the end of the meal, one glass is all that is required. A dessert wine bottle holds about eight glasses based on a 3-ounce serving size. A 750-ml bottle of wine contains about 5 servings, so divide the number of wine drinks by 5 to come up with the number of bottles you’ll need. TIP: For a sit down dinner with wine only, an easy assumption is half a bottle of wine per person. Champagne. One 750-ml bottle of Champagne fills 6 regular Champagne glasses. If you are having a ... Web20 Dec 2024 · Choose at least 2-4 different types of wine but no more than 6 for bigger parties. It’s always best to provide options for red wine and white, and/or blush wine to your guests. You can get away with serving only one red and one white, as long as they’re versatile. Learning a bit more about wines will help you pair correctly.
